Dizzy Fae on setting intentions and her self care routine

For artist Dizzy Fae, beauty is simple. It's about eating good food, staying moisturised, being gentle with herself - and knowing sometimes you just need to ask yourself if you're okay.

Her happy-go-lucky take on life is infectious. Dizzy says that being surrounded by people that care for you is one of the coolest things in the world and blasting music in the car is essential, even if you're not going anywhere. Here, we delve into her wellness routine and why she says it's important to set intentions.

 

What is your morning beauty routine?

I wake up and I try to smile in bed before getting out haha.. cause it makes me feel good. Then I go to the bathroom to brush my teeth and take a leak. I like to empty out all that needs to be free, because my beauty routine should start from the inside out. After that I usually just light-wash my face and put a moisturiser with SPF on.

 

What is your night beauty routine?

To get ready for slumber, I throw my bonnet on, wash my face, apply some oils that will seep through the night, and finish with some night cream. There’s also beauty in reading before bed, so I do that often.

What is the supermarket/ drug store/ chemist beauty product(s) that you use and love?

I love black soap! My homie Sham introduced me to it heavy on tour this year and I really think it's helping my skin. Besides that I'm still trying to figure out the best products for me, I can't really vouch for anything else right now.

 

Images: Instagram; Instagram; SHEA MOISTURE Organic African Black Soap.

 

What is your main form of beauty body maintenance? What products do you use on your body?

I started using jojoba oil for my body pretty recently and I think my skin likes that a lot. My skin also changes what satisfies it with the season. I have eczema so in the winter I always have to apply a heavier body cream like shea butter or something recommended by a dermatologist. I also use pretty clean deodorant, but again still trying to find the best.. damn the journey.
